The effect of different levels of nitrogen [N] and phosphorus [P] fertilizers on the amino acid, fatty acid and essential oil composition of Nigella sativa L. seeds were studied. Fertilization at a level of 100 Kg of each [N] and [P]/hectar and 50 Kg [P]/hectar, markedly increased the amino acid composition as well as the thymoquinone content of the essential oil. Treatment with 100 kg [N] and 200 Kg[P]/hectar significant increased the content of 11, 14-eicosadienoic acid in the fixed oil
